6 ft. Toilet Auger with Bulb Head

The RIDGID 6 ft. Toilet Auger is a high-quality tool designed to provide safe and easy cleaning of toilet obstructions. The bulb-head auger features a compression-wrapped inner cable. Full lifetime warranty against material defects and workmanship.

I was surprised to see snakes listed for a $10, alongside one for $50. I couldn't imagine why I'd need to spend $50.
It took a trip to the store to see them up close to compare.
Ok, you can get a basic snake with no frills. I'll bet it would work fine, but you'd get your hands and the bowl (where it rubs) messy. I know, I tried a lightweight coil that was rusty and I still haven't gotten that rust off the bowl.
Moving up in price, you get some in "containers" that wind up. While you'd think the handle would reel it in, it does not. So again, you'd be handling the snake that was just down inside your nasty toilet pipes.
Ignoring the crazy expensive versions that I'd imagine only plumbers or handymen would buy, I saw three products in the running.
This one, which is 6' long, a 3' version and a cheaper version in the same fashion. The cheaper version was MUCH cheaper, at $10. I almost bought it. I'll bet it would be enough for most clogs. It seemed like a smaller diameter coil, though, so I decided against it.
So it was down to the 3' and the 6'. Assuming this is the last toilet snake I'll ever buy it wouldn't have made sense to get the 3'.
So how does it work? It was so effortless that I didn't believe it was actually extending into the pipe. My old toilet has really crazy bends and I was worried about it making those bends. I made one complete, six foot pass and tried the toilet to find it still impeded. I made a second pass, this time spending more time working it around in different fdirections as it went in and out. This time when I pulled it out, it had a large mass of paper.
My toilet hasn't flushed this nicely in a long time!
